Why Community Ownership can work

Aberdeen Branch Ayr United Supporters Club 

On Wednesday 19 June 2013 Ayr United Chairman Lachlan Cameron read out a statement at the club’s annual general meeting on the future of the 103 year old Honest Men. The statement announced the formation of a working group comprising a number of the club’s stakeholders, including the Ayr United Football Academy and Honest Men Trust. The group, facilitated by Supporters Direct Scotland, will investigate the “feasibility and requirements of potentially bringing the ownership of Ayr United into a community model”. Читать дальше...

Selfless Malcolm a great assist for United

Aberdeen Branch Ayr United Supporters Club 

Striker Craig Malcolm currently finds himself out of the Ayr United first team, having lost his place to Kevin Kyle. The summer signing from Stranraer – who scored 48 goals in 112 appearances for the Stair Park club and netted 18 times in the Second Division last season – started the season in decent form, forming a promising partnership with Michael Moffat but struggled to find the net, scoring twice in 10 starts. At times, the 26 year-old’s finishing has been poor and he has squandered a number of very presentable opportunities... Читать дальше...

STATS! Michael Moffat's 50 goals for Ayr United

Aberdeen Branch Ayr United Supporters Club 

Michael Moffat signed for Ayr United on 10th January 2011 from South Ayrshire Junior club Girvan. The striker quickly became a fans favourite and was instrumental in the Honest Men's promotion via the play-offs at the end of that season, scoring in each of Ayr's four play-off ties, including a memorable winner at Glebe Park. On Saturday 12th October 2013, the Moff scored his 50th goal for the club, in his 120th starting appearance. To celebrate, here is an in-depth look at those 50 goals:

STATS! United's all-time record on artificial surfaces

Aberdeen Branch Ayr United Supporters Club 

Ayr United travel to Ochilview on Saturday to face Stenhousemuir with a less than glorious recent record on artificial surfaces. United played 9 fixtures on artificial surfaces last season - including four games at Station Park - and failed to win any of them, starting with a shock defeat to East Stirlingshire on the opening day of the season. In all the Honest Men have played 30 competitive fixtures on artificial surfaces. Here is a run down of some statistics covering those games:

Progression not punishment most important as Scottish football faces up to newco Rangers

Aberdeen Branch Ayr United Supporters Club 

After four months in administration, the reformation of Rangers FC is now a certainty following Her Majesty’s Revenue & Customs rejection of a company voluntary arrangement aimed at saving the 140 year-old club. The corporate entity which is The Rangers Football Club plc will be liquidated and new company created.
